Summary:

As an Area Sales Manager, you will play a pivotal role in driving sales growth and expanding our market presence across a designated region.

This is a high-impact sales role responsible for developing and growing the Buttress Group’s presence within the market. The successful candidate will leverage their existing network of dealer contacts to introduce and sell the Maidaid equipment range, Caterparts spare parts, and Crystaltech preventative maintenance services. You will play a key role in developing strategic relationships with major dealers and service partners to deliver sustainable sales growth across the Group portfolio.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ute a targeted sales strategy for the area across Maidaid, Caterparts, and Crystaltech.
  • Leverage existing relationships within the territory to secure new business opportunities and partnerships.
  • Build and maintain relationships with key decision-makers including procurement, operations, and maintenance teams.
  • Deliver sales growth through equipment placements, spare parts supply agreements, and preventative maintenance contracts.
  • Work cross-functionally with internal teams (sales, service, logistics, and marketing) to ensure seamless customer delivery and support.
  • Negotiate contracts and pricing in line with group strategy and profitability goals.
  • Monitor market trends and competitor activity to identify new opportunities and ensure the Group remains a preferred partner in the QSR space.
  • Provide regular reporting on sales pipeline, activity, and performance to the Group Sales Director / Exec team (as required).

Key Requirements

  • Proven track record of sales success in the QSR or foodservice equipment industry.
  • Strong understanding of equipment supply chains, spare parts, and maintenance/service solutions.
  • Excellent communication, negotiation, and relationship management skills.
  • Commercially astute with a results-driven mindset.
  • Comfortable working autonomously with accountability for targets.
  • Full UK driving licence and willingness to travel nationwide.
